,即通过使用JavaScript编写函数来实现div元素的动态效果。具体步骤如下:
- 首先,需要在HTML文件中添加一个div元素,并为其指定一个唯一的id属性值,例如:id="myDiv"。
- 接下来,在JavaScript代码中定义一个函数,例如:dynamicDiv()。
- 在dynamicDiv()函数中,可以通过getElementById()方法获取到div元素的引用,例如:var divElement = document.getElementById("myDiv")。
- 然后,可以使用divElement.style属性来修改div元素的样式,以达到动态化的效果。例如,通过修改divElement.style.backgroundColor来改变div元素的背景颜色,通过修改divElement.style.width和divElement.style.height来改变div元素的尺寸等。
- 最后,在需要触发div元素动态化的时机,例如点击按钮或者页面加载完成时,调用dynamicDiv()函数即可实现div元素的动态效果。
使用JavaScript动态化div元素的好处包括:
- 提升用户体验:通过动态化div元素,可以增加页面的交互性和视觉效果,提升用户的使用体验。
- 增强可维护性:通过将动态效果的实现封装在函数中,可以提高代码的可维护性和复用性,便于后续的修改和扩展。
- 实现个性化需求:通过动态化div元素,可以根据具体需求实现各种特定的动态效果,例如动画、渐变等,满足个性化的设计要求。
腾讯云相关产品和产品介绍链接地址:
腾讯云提供了丰富的云计算产品,其中与前端开发相关的产品包括云服务器、云函数、云存储等。详细信息请参考腾讯云官方网站:
- 云服务器(Elastic Cloud Server,ECS):提供按需分配的虚拟服务器实例,可满足不同规模和业务需求。产品介绍链接:https://cloud.tencent.com/product/cvm
- 云函数(Serverless Cloud Function,SCF):支持无服务器函数计算,具有高可用、灵活扩展、按需付费等特点,适用于前端开发中的异步处理和事件驱动场景。产品介绍链接:https://cloud.tencent.com/product/scf
- 云存储(Cloud Object Storage,COS):提供高可靠、低成本、高扩展性的对象存储服务,可用于存储前端应用的静态资源、图片、视频等。产品介绍链接:https://cloud.tencent.com/product/cos